From download to running in 3 steps

  1. 1
    Import. In n8n, open Workflows → menu → “Import from File” and pick the downloaded JSON.
  2. 2
    Connect. Add your own credentials on the app nodes - n8n highlights exactly which ones need them.
  3. 3
    Activate. Run it once to test, then toggle Active. The automation is live.

How do I import it into n8n?

In n8n, open Workflows, click the three-dot menu, choose “Import from File”, and select the downloaded JSON. Then connect your own app credentials on the highlighted nodes.
